ローカルIPアドレスとは?プライベートアドレスについて解説
ITの初心者
先生、『ローカルIPアドレス』とは一体何を指しているのですか?
IT・PC専門家
それはプライベートIPアドレスのことを指すよ。プライベートということは、インターネット上に公開されていないという意味なんだ。
ITの初心者
インターネットに公開されていないということは、具体的にはどのような場面で使用されるのですか?
IT・PC専門家
主に自宅やオフィスのネットワークなど、限られた範囲内で利用されることが多いよ。具体的な例としては、プリンターをネットワークに接続する場合などでも使用されるんだ。
ローカルIPアドレスとは。
「ローカルIPアドレス」とは、主に企業や家庭などの社内ネットワークで使用されるプライベートなIPアドレスのことを指します。
ローカルIPアドレスの定義
ローカルIPアドレスとは、プライベートネットワーク内でのみ使用可能なIPアドレスを指します。このアドレスは、インターネット上の他のネットワークからはアクセスできないため、特定のネットワーク内のデバイスを識別するために使用されます。例えば、家庭内のネットワークでは、ルーターが192.168.1.1などのローカルIPアドレスを持つことが一般的です。このアドレスを通じて、ネットワーク内の他のデバイスがそのルーターに接続し、インターネットにアクセスできるようになります。
プライベートアドレスとの関係
プライベートアドレスは、主にプライベートネットワーク内で使用されるIPアドレスの範囲を指します。これらのアドレスはインターネット上には公開されておらず、特定のネットワーク内でのデバイス間の通信にのみ使用されます。一方で、ローカルIPアドレスは、特定のネットワーク環境内で使用されることが多く、プライベートアドレスの一部として位置づけられています。このため、基本的には単一のネットワークセグメント内でのみ利用されます。
プライベートアドレスは、インターネットプロトコル(IP)の特定の範囲で定義されており、ルーターやファイアウォールといったネットワークデバイスによって外部ネットワークから隔離されています。この仕組みによって、プライベートネットワーク内のデバイスは外部からのアクセスや攻撃から保護されることになります。ローカルIPアドレスは、プライベートアドレスの中でもさらに限定的な形態で、通常は家庭や小規模なオフィスなどの小規模なネットワークで利用されます。
ローカルIPアドレスの種類
ローカルIPアドレスには、以下のような多様な種類が存在します。
10.0.0.0 ~ 10.255.255.255 の範囲は、プライベートアドレス空間の「Class A」ネットワークに該当します。この範囲内のアドレスは、インターネット上ではルーティングされることはありません。
172.16.0.0 ~ 172.31.255.255 の範囲もプライベートアドレス空間に属し、「Class B」ネットワークに分類されます。
192.168.0.0 ~ 192.168.255.255 の範囲は、再びプライベートアドレス空間であり、「Class C」ネットワークに該当します。
これらのプライベートアドレスは、内部ネットワーク内で使用され、インターネットに接続するためのルーターやモデムの背後で機能します。
ローカルIPアドレスの割り当て
ローカルIPアドレスの割り当ては、ネットワーク内の各デバイスに固有の識別子を提供する重要なプロセスです。通常、この割り当ては自動的にルーターやDHCP(Dynamic Host Configuration Protocol)サーバーによって行われます。具体的に言うと、ルーターは、各デバイスに対してプライベートアドレスの範囲内からアドレスを割り当て、その範囲は 192.168.0.0 ~ 192.168.255.255 です。これにより、デバイス同士がローカルネットワーク内でスムーズに通信できるようになります。
ローカルIPアドレスの利用シーン
ローカルIPアドレスは、プライベートなネットワーク内でデバイスを特定するために使用されます。一般的に見られる利用シーンは次の通りです。
* -ホームネットワーク- 家庭内のコンピュータ、スマートフォン、プリンターなどのデバイスを接続し、ファイル共有や印刷、さらにはオンラインゲームなどの機能を利用することができます。
* -オフィスネットワーク- 社内のコンピュータやサーバー、ネットワークプリンターを接続し、コラボレーションやリソースへのアクセスを容易にする役割を果たします。
* -学校ネットワーク- 生徒や教職員のデバイスを接続し、インターネットへのアクセスやリソースの共有、オンライン学習の環境を提供することが可能です。
* -ホテルやカフェ- ゲストに一時的なインターネットアクセスを提供するためにWi-Fiネットワークを構築する際に利用されます。